Jasrathpura Population - Bhind, Madhya Pradesh

Jasrathpura is a medium size village located in Gohad Tehsil of Bhind district, Madhya Pradesh with total 259 families residing. The Jasrathpura village has population of 1453 of which 792 are males while 661 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Jasrathpura village population of children with age 0-6 is 180 which makes up 12.39 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jasrathpura village is 835 which is lower than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Jasrathpura as per census is 818, lower than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Jasrathpura village has higher liter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Jasrathpura village was 89.95 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Jasrathpura Male literacy stands at 93.65 % while female literacy rate was 85.52 %.

Caste Factor

Jasrathpura village of Bhind has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 28.97 % of total population in Jasrathpura village. The village Jasrathpura curr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Jasrathpura village out of total population, 453 were engaged in work activities. 86.75 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 13.25 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 453 workers engaged in Main Work, 208 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 150 were Agricultural labourer.
